- Amadou Jean Tigana is a French former football player and manager. A central midfielder, he was renowned as one of the best midfielders in the world during the 1980s. He spent his entire playing career in France, and made 52 appearances and scored one goal for the France national team. Following his playing career, he became a manager, coaching clubs in France, England, Turkey and China. | Jean Tigana, French footballer and manager
